Who Killed Our Father? (2023) — A DNA Thriller Unraveling Deadly Secrets

Director Roxanne Boisvert crafts a gripping psychological thriller in *Who Killed Our Father? (2023)*, where Leila's search for identity takes a deadly turn. After her foster sister's sudden death, Leila traces her biological roots through a DNA test, uncovering a sister and a father she never knew. But just as she prepares to reunite, her father is brutally murdered, pulling her into a web of deception and danger far darker than she anticipated. With a tense atmosphere and razor-sharp suspense, this 90-minute TV movie explores themes of family secrets, hidden truths, and the unforeseen consequences of uncovering the past.

Starring Joanne Boland as Leila, alongside Angela Besharah, Sam Ashe Arnold, and Konstantina Mantelos, the film blends emotional depth with high-stakes thriller elements.
